The Rise of Gig Work
In the early 2000s, the gig economy began to flourish, driven by platforms like Uber, TaskRabbit, and Fiverr. These platforms connected individuals offering various services directly with those seeking them. The flexibility, autonomy, and opportunity for diverse income streams made gig work particularly appealing to many. However, this era was fundamentally human-driven, relying on the skills, judgment, and creativity of individuals.
The Dawn of Technological Integration
As technology advanced, the integration of AI and robotics into the gig economy started to take shape. Companies began leveraging AI for scheduling, matching, and optimizing tasks. For example, AI algorithms can predict demand patterns, helping to allocate work more efficiently. This technological integration began to address some of the inefficiencies inherent in human-only gig work, such as delays in task matching and over-reliance on human judgment.
AI-Powered Tools Enhancing Gig Work
Today, various AI-powered tools are enhancing gig work. For instance, chatbots provide 24/7 customer support on gig platforms, handling queries that would otherwise require human intervention. Predictive analytics help gig workers understand trends and optimize their availability and pricing strategies. AI-driven platforms also offer skill assessments and recommendations, helping freelancers improve their service offerings and increase their chances of getting work.
Robotic Innovations in Gig Work
The role of robotics in gig work is becoming increasingly prominent. Autonomous delivery drones and robots are now handling delivery tasks, reducing the need for human couriers in certain scenarios. On the service side, robots equipped with AI are performing tasks like cleaning and maintenance in commercial spaces. These robotic solutions not only increase efficiency but also open up new opportunities for human workers to focus on more complex, creative, and high-value tasks.

Understanding Smart Contracts
At the core of the metaverse lies the concept of smart contracts—self-executing agreements coded on the blockchain. These contracts automate processes, ensuring that conditions are met before actions are taken. From decentralized finance (DeFi) to non-fungible tokens (NFTs), smart contracts power the backbone of many metaverse applications. Their potential is vast, yet so are the risks associated with their misuse.
Emerging Threats in the Metaverse
While the metaverse promises an immersive and interactive experience, it also attracts malicious actors. Here’s a glimpse into some of the prevalent threats:
Phishing and Social Engineering: Cybercriminals exploit human psychology to trick users into divulging private keys or sensitive information. Phishing attacks often masquerade as legitimate entities to lure unsuspecting victims.
Smart Contract Vulnerabilities: Bugs and flaws within the code can be exploited to manipulate contracts, resulting in significant financial losses. For instance, a minor oversight might allow unauthorized transactions or fund siphoning.
Front Running: In the fast-paced world of DeFi, malicious actors might exploit pending transactions to their advantage. By monitoring blockchain networks, they can execute trades ahead of legitimate users, often at their expense.
Denial of Service (DoS) Attacks: These attacks aim to disrupt smart contract functions by overwhelming them with transaction requests, rendering the contract unusable until the assault subsides.
Best Practices for Smart Contract Security
To navigate the intricate landscape of smart contract security, consider these best practices:
Code Auditing: Regular, thorough audits of smart contract code by reputable firms can uncover vulnerabilities before they are exploited. This proactive approach minimizes risks.
Formal Verification: Leveraging formal verification methods ensures that the logic of smart contracts adheres to intended specifications. This technique enhances the contract's robustness and reliability.
Bug Bounty Programs: Engaging the community in identifying vulnerabilities through bug bounty programs fosters a collaborative security environment. This approach often leads to the discovery of hard-to-find flaws.
Multi-Signature Wallets: Implementing multi-signature wallets adds an extra layer of security. Transactions require approval from multiple authorized parties, making unauthorized access significantly more challenging.
Regular Updates: Keeping smart contracts and associated software up-to-date mitigates the risk of exploitation through known vulnerabilities. Regular updates often include patches for newly identified threats.

Advanced Security Measures
Zero-Knowledge Proofs (ZKPs):
Zero-knowledge proofs provide a sophisticated method for verifying the validity of a transaction or statement without revealing any additional information. This technology can enhance privacy and security in smart contracts by allowing parties to prove compliance with specific conditions without disclosing sensitive data.
Random Oracle Model:
The random oracle model is a theoretical construct used in cryptographic proofs to model real-world hash functions. By employing this model, developers can create more secure and robust smart contracts that are less susceptible to attacks.
Immutable Blockchain Analysis:
Blockchain’s immutable nature allows for comprehensive analysis of transaction histories. Advanced analytics and machine learning can be employed to detect anomalies and potential security breaches, providing an additional layer of protection.
Secure Enclaves:
Secure enclaves, or hardware security modules (HSMs), offer a physical layer of security for sensitive operations. By isolating critical functions within secure hardware, smart contracts can perform complex computations and manage private keys safely.
